People normally recall of ATMs (Automatic Teller Machines), or cash-points, every bit a place for withdrawing cash from a bank account. Yet, many ATMs allow you to deposit money as well. The process varies by bank and ATM, and you lot should refer to your banking company'southward policies and follow the prompts at the ATM, only the post-obit steps are by and large relevant to most ATM eolith transactions.

  1. one

    Verify that the ATM accepts deposits placed in an envelope. Smaller ATMs and those at non-bank locations such every bit convenience stores or restaurants may not have this function. If information technology does non have a marked slot for dispensing and/or accepting envelopes, it does not accept envelope deposits.

    • Some mod bank ATMs may just accept non-envelope deposits. See elsewhere in this commodity for data on making such deposits.
    • Your bank may not permit deposits at ATMs not affiliated with it. Check your financial institution's policies.
  2. ii

    Insert your ATM or debit card and enter your PIN number. This part of the process is exactly the same equally when you withdraw cash.

    • Locate the "eolith" tab on the screen or respective button indicated past the screen (on older machines). If at that place is no eolith option, yous're out of luck on this ATM.

  3. iii

    Endorse any checks to be deposited. Sign them on the back in the marked area.

    • Add together "for eolith only" below your signature for added security. If you lose this endorsed check, information technology can simply exist deposited, not cashed.
  4. 4

    Prepare a deposit slip. If you are using a slip from your checkbook, your name, accost, and business relationship number should already be on the check.

    • If you are using a blank deposit sideslip, similar those available in a banking concern branch, fill out your proper name, address, and account number. Add the date to whatsoever type of deposit skid.
    • Enter the total amount of cash to be deposited on the marked line, and individually listing checks in the provided slots on the front (and, if needed, back) of the slip.
    • Enter the total amount of all checks and cash to be deposited on the provided line.
    • Yous don't need to sign a eolith slip when depositing funds into an ATM. A signature is just required when you seek cash back from a deposit fabricated at a teller window.
    • You may want to sign your checks and gear up your deposit sideslip ahead of fourth dimension, for convenience and rubber. Limiting your fourth dimension at the ATM is safer and less likely to annoy those in line backside y'all.
  5. 5

    Use the eolith envelope provided by the ATM. Older machines may have a pocket-sized door that yous lift open to reveal eolith envelopes, while newer machines may just spit them out of a slot.

    • Even if you have your deposit organized into an envelope, transfer information technology to the one provided by the machine.
    • Make sure yous insert all your checks, cash, and the deposit skid into the envelope. Seal it securely.
    • Write in any information, such as proper noun, date, and the deposit amount, requested on the exterior of the envelope (as indicated by labeled blank lines).
    • The ATM may ask you if y'all need more time while preparing your eolith. Press the indicated button to give yourself added time to go everything in club.
  6. 6

    Insert your completed and sealed envelope and verify your eolith. The slot where you insert the envelope should exist conspicuously marked and may be indicated by flashing lights. Information technology may besides exist the aforementioned slot where yous received your eolith envelope.

    • When prompted by the ATM, either before or subsequently making the actual deposit, enter the total amount of your deposit. Write the total amount down on a scrap of paper beforehand if you need a reminder.
    • Take care to exist accurate. The depository financial institution should be able to correct any discrepancies, only it is quicker and easier to get things right the outset time.
    • Confirm that you want a receipt and keep it for your records, at least until your deposits articulate.
  7. 7

    Wait for your deposits to articulate. Deposits of cash or bank check past envelope are manually counted and entered into your business relationship, so funds will non be available immediately.

    • A common expect time for fund availability from an ATM deposit is the 2nd business mean solar day after the deposit. That is, if you deposit the funds on Monday, they will be available Wed. But, if you deposit them Sunday (not a concern twenty-four hours), it volition also be Wednesday. Banks are required to consider ATM deposits made past apex to be made that business day.[one]

  1. 1

    Verify that the ATM accepts no-envelope deposits. This is increasingly condign the standard in ATMs at depository financial institution branches, and it is condign more than common in other locations. Wait for notices on the screen or on the machine itself.[ii]

    • No-envelope ATMs normally have clearly-marked, carve up slots for checks and cash.
    • Insert your card, enter your PIN, and follow the prompts to brand a deposit. The ATM will verify at some betoken whether y'all can make no-envelope deposits.
  2. 2

    Endorse and prepare your checks. You volition non need a deposit skid for a no-envelope transaction.

    • You may want to add together up the full dollar amount of your check deposits beforehand, in order to compare to the total tabulated by the ATM. You lot volition be able to become through deposited checks individually if at that place is a discrepancy.
  3. 3

    Feed checks into the marked slot when prompted. Many machines tin can read the checks regardless of orientation, but it tin't hurt to stack your checks neatly and facing in the same direction.

    • You lot do not need to feed the checks individually at most newer machines. The maximum number of checks you can feed at once should be displayed on the screen or machine; one national bank chain states a maximum of 30 checks at once.[3]
  4. 4

    Make sure that the total amount is correct and complete your transaction. You should be able to get through checks individually and make corrections if needed.

    • Many machines offering the option of printing an paradigm of the front of your cheque(s) on your receipt. Apply this option if y'all'd like an added layer of proof of deposit for your records.
    • Rejected checks -- those with unreadable printing or handwriting, for case -- should be returned to you lot at the stop of your transaction. Contact the bank if this does not happen.
  5. 5

    Deposit cash into the appropriate slot according to the ATM's limit. One mutual maximum for a stack of cash is 50 bills.[4]

    • Again, the machine should be able to read cash in any direction, but a not bad stack tin can just speed the process.
    • Unlike envelope deposits, where they can exist deposited together, cash and checks volition demand to be deposited in carve up transactions. Eolith i, indicate you lot'd similar to brand another transaction when prompted on the screen, then deposit the other.
  6. 6

    Find out when deposits volition be credited to your account. This will vary by financial institution.

    • One advantage of non-envelope greenbacks deposits is that the money is immediately available in your account because information technology has been scanned and confirmed. Envelope cash deposits, on the other paw, need to be opened, counted, and entered. If you need to add funds to your account right abroad and don't take access to a banking company branch, a non-envelope cash deposit may exist your best bet.
    • Check deposits will even so require fourth dimension to clear after being posted; one national bank considers non-envelope check deposits made by 8 pm to be posted that business 24-hour interval, and it should clear on the second business concern day after (posted Monday, cleared Midweek, for example).[5]

  • Question

    How long will it take the money I deposit to announced in my account?

    Each banking concern has a policy regarding when yous can access funds afterward you make deposit through an ATM. Generally, funds will be available on the second business concern day after deposit, although the bank may allow partial withdrawals in the acting. Factors that bear on fund availability include the nature of the deposit (greenbacks, electronic funds, paper checks), the corporeality of funds deposited, the customer's history and relationship to the banking concern, and the source of the eolith (bank-owned or independent ATM). Bank check with your depository financial institution to identify their specific policies and procedures regarding availability of deposits.
